The Role

You’ll be building pipeline with US law enforcement agencies, speaking directly with investigators, detectives, and senior stakeholders to understand how they manage seized assets, where their processes break down, and whether there’s a real opportunity to remove an obstacle they face.

This is not a high-volume SDR role. You won’t succeed here by making hundreds of calls a week. You’ll succeed through research which leads you to running better conversations with the right people: asking the right questions, listening carefully, building trust and value for the prospect, and converting genuine interest into qualified pipeline to hand off to the Sales team.

The only prerequisites are that you have a proven, successful history of performing against targets with SaaS products to the public sector, and that you are a good culture add for Asset Reality.

Asset Reality is the first company in the world to provide a complete solution for both physical and virtual assets; making it easier to seize, manage, and dispose of them. Our platform replaces outdated, fragmented systems with a secure, end-to-end solution designed for law enforcement and government agencies
